Is there a disorder that causes a broken jaw/misalignment as a child and possibly other bone issues like hip dysplasia? a congenital issue?

Maybe: There are some congenital bone diseases that cause weak bones, but you would typically know about such a disease soon after you are born. It is best to discuss this with your physician who is more familiar with the particular aspects of your medical history.

Possibly: Check out osteogenesis imperfecta. Although there are other possibilities, if there is a familial history of these issues this is worth considering.
